info_outlineIn this episode of The Brave Enough Show, Dr. Sasha Shillcutt discusses:
-
How Understanding Your Personality is KEY to Self Care
-
How Self Awareness is KEY to Emotionally Intelligence
-
How Understanding Your Core Motivation Gives You Energy
-
Understanding Your Core Fears and How They Influence Your Decision Making
"If you want to take care of and manage yourself, you must understand your core motivation, core fear, core weakness, and core strengths." - Dr. Sasha Shillcutt
Brave Enough CME Conference 2025
This conference will specifically address how to combat isolation of women working in healthcare with strategies to foster deeper connections and promote accountability. The conference will cover specific topics to create allyship and peer mentorship by focusing on topics women in medicine face in order to leave the conference with strong allies. We want every woman to leave with a group of friends that can be there for her all year through. Attendees will have time to connect with phenomenal speakers, ask questions, and experience live coaching in a protected, safe environment.
